Standardised Automation Governance and Reduced Failure Rates, Microsoft 35 Migration and Improved Compliance / Productivity for a Global Telco Provider

Telecommunication

PROJECT OBJECTIVE

Design and implement a robust automation governance framework and modern collaboration environment to reduce automation failure rates, strengthen regulatory and data compliance, and boost workforce productivity across the client’s global operations.​​​​​

Client Challenges​
&​
Pain Points​

  • Lack of standardised governance for automation platforms​
  • High robot failure rates and exceptions.​​​​

Approach
&​
How We Helped

  • Defined automation roadmap with best-practice governance​​​​​
  • Introduced rigorous testing protocols to minimise failures​
  • Migrated Google Workspace → Microsoft 365​​
  • Implemented Microsoft Purview for compliance and data governance​​
  • Optimised collaboration with Teams, Exchange, and SharePoint.​

Value
Provided

  • Strategic Impact: Automation became a core capability, enabling faster delivery cycles and improved compliance across global operations.​
  • Reduced automation exceptions and failures by 50%​
  • Seamless migration with minimal disruption​​​​​​
  • Enhanced productivity and compliance​
